The Harbour and Terminal Management course is designed for professionals working in the maritime industry, focusing on the efficient management of ports and terminals.

Developed for those seeking to enhance their knowledge and skills in harbour and terminal operations, this course covers topics such as cargo handling, vessel operations, and logistics management.

Through a combination of theoretical and practical learning, participants will gain a deeper understanding of the complexities involved in harbour and terminal management, including safety protocols, environmental regulations, and supply chain optimization.

By the end of the course, learners will be equipped with the knowledge and expertise necessary to effectively manage harbour and terminal operations, ensuring seamless and efficient cargo movement.
